  • The Essential Basics of Backgammon Game Plans – Part 1

    The objective of a Backgammon game is to shift your chips around the Backgammon board and pull them off the board quicker than your challenger who works just as hard to attempt the same buthowever they move in the opposing direction. Winning a round in Backgammon requires both strategy and good luck. Just how far you will be able to shift your chips is up to the numbers from tossing the dice, and how you shift your chips are decided on by your overall gambling strategies. Enthusiasts use a number of plans in the differing parts of a game dependent on your positions and opponent’s.

    The Running Game Strategy

    The goal of the Running Game technique is to bring all your checkers into your home board and pull them off as quickly as you could. This tactic concentrates on the speed of moving your chips with little or no efforts to hit or barricade your opponent’s checkers. The ideal time to employ this plan is when you believe you might be able to move your own checkers faster than your opposing player does: when 1) you have a fewer chips on the game board; 2) all your checkers have moved beyond your competitor’s checkers; or 3) the opposing player doesn’t use the hitting or blocking strategy.

    The Blocking Game Strategy

    The main goal of the blocking plan, by its name, is to stop the opponent’s chips, temporarily, while not fretting about moving your checkers quickly. After you have established the blockage for your competitor’s movement with a few checkers, you can shift your other chips swiftly from the board. The player really should also have a clear plan when to extract and move the chips that you utilized for blocking. The game becomes intriguing when your opposition uses the same blocking tactic.

  • Backgammon – 3 General Schemes

    [ English ]

    In very simple terms, there are three main tactics used. You want to be able to hop between tactics almost instantly as the action of the match unfolds.

    The Blockade

    This is comprised of assembling a 6-thick wall of pieces, or at a minimum as thick as you might manage, to barricade in the competitor’s checkers that are on your 1-point. This is considered to be the most acceptable tactic at the begining of the game. You can create the wall anywhere within your eleven-point and your 2-point and then shuffle it into your home board as the match progresses.

    The Blitz

    This is comprised of locking your home board as quick as as you can while keeping your competitor on the bar. For example, if your opponent tosses an early two and moves one checker from your one-point to your three-point and you then roll a 5-5, you can play six/one six/one eight/three eight/three. Your competitor is then in serious calamity due to the fact that they have two checkers on the bar and you have locked half your home board!

    The Backgame

    This strategy is where you have two or higher anchors in your opponent’s home board. (An anchor is a point consisting of at a minimum two of your pieces.) It needs to be employed when you are decidedly behind as this strategy greatly improves your circumstances. The strongest places for anchor spots are towards your competitor’s smaller points and either on adjacent points or with a single point in between. Timing is critical for an effectual backgame: after all, there’s no point having 2 nice anchor spots and a solid wall in your own inner board if you are then required to break apart this straight away, while your opposer is moving their pieces home, taking into account that you don’t have any other additional checkers to shift! In this case, it is more favorable to have checkers on the bar so that you are able to preserve your position until your challenger provides you a chance to hit, so it will be an excellent idea to try and get your competitor to hit them in this case!
